What are the pharmacological targets for acid regulation related to the parietal cell?
- M3: Muscarinic antagonists affect the Ca²⁺-dependent pathway.
- H2: H₂ antagonists affect the cAMP-dependent pathway.
- EP3: Misoprostol affects the parietal cell.
- H⁺, K⁺ ATPase: Proton pump inhibitors target this enzyme.

What are the advantages of Aluminium Hydroxide?
- Long duration of action.
- Very effective.
- It does not release CO2, thus does not cause distension.
- It does not induce changes in acid-base balance.

What are the components included in local antacids?
- Aluminium hydroxide
- Calcium carbonate
- Magnesium hydroxide
- Magnesium trisilicate
What are the disadvantages of Aluminium Hydroxide?
- Constipation (combined with Magnesium salts which have laxative action).
- Hypophosphatemia leading to osteomalasia.
- Chelates Tetracyclines, Digoxin, Iron salts, and Anticholinergic drugs in intestine.
- Encephalopathy in renal failure.

What are the advantages of Calcium Carbonate?
- Potent
- Rapid onset
- No change in systemic pH
What are the clinical uses of systemic antacids like NaHCO3?
- Peptic ulcer (for immediate relief of ulcer pain)
- Treatment of hyperacidity
- Treatment of acidosis
- Urinary tract infections
- Urate stones (by alkalinization of urine)
- Treatment of salicylate toxicity (by alkalinization of urine)

What are the disadvantages of Calcium Carbonate?
- Constipation.
- Milk-alkali syndrome with milk (40% of Calcium is absorbed).
- Hypercalcuria, Renal stones.
- Rebound hyperacidity due to gastrin release.
What are the two main actions of antacids?
- Increase stomach pH, relieving pain caused by ulcers.
- Decrease gut hyper-motility.

What are the three main categories of anti-acids?
- Local Non-absorbable Anti-acids
- Systemic (absorbable) Antacids
- Complex anti-acids
List the disadvantages of sodium bicarbonate as an antacid.
- Can cause rebound hyperacidity by increasing HCl secretion
- Dissolves mucous in the stomach
- Results in systemic alkalosis on continued use
- Alkalinization of urine leading to phosphate stones
- Short duration of action
What are examples of Systemic (absorbable) Antacids?
- Sodium citrate
- Sodium bicarbonate
